Performance Management Planning Worksheet
This worksheet helps you clarify and answer key questions related to designing a new
performance management process for your organization. It should be used in tandem with
the C
reating a Performance Management Process that Works guide, and it can be used
individually or as a discussion guide with your task force.
Identify Strengths and Gaps in Performance Processes
Consider each of the performance processes individually to note what’s working with the
current approach, where changes are needed, and what is completely missing.
PLANNING
● Individual
expectations
● Team
expectations
● Resources
CULTIVATION
● Motivation
● Removing
obstacles
● Coaching
● Appreciation
ACCOUNTABILITY
● Measurement
● Feedback
● Ownership
